Locals form committee to arrest thieves in Mohmand
Weary of the ever increasing number of theft incidents in the locality, a grand Jirga of Mohmand tribal district’s Kandharo area has decided to take matters in their own hands by appointing a 48-member Jirga to bring the situation under control.
The Jirga took place on Sunday which was attended by a large number of people. They expressed their dissatisfaction over the steps taken by the local administration and police and decided to take steps on their own to identify and arrest the thieves involved in the ever increasing number of theft incidents.
For the past two months, a gang of thieves is involved in breaking into the houses at night and stealing gold and cash. Despite the repeated complaints, local police has failed to arrest the gang.
